Replacing the Cutter Blade

CAUTION
To prevent cutting your fingers, always handle the cutter blade with caution.

(1) Turn the blade-length adjustment knob to retract the blade into the plunger.
(2) Turn the plunger cap in the counter-clockwise direction to remove it from the plunger.
(3) Remove the blade from inside the plunger cap.
(4) Insert the new blade into the hole provided in the plunger cap.
(5) With the blade inserted into the plunger cap, screw on the plunger from above.

Adjusting the Blade Length

If the blade is extended too far in relation to the thickness of the medium being cut, it will damage
the cutting mat. Be sure to adjust the blade length correctly.
CAUTION
To prevent cutting your fingers, always handle the cutter blade with caution.
(1) Adjust the blade length by turning the blade-length adjustment knob. Turn the knob in direction
"A" to extend the blade, or in direction "B" to retract the blade. When the knob is turned by
one scale unit, the blade moves approximately 0.1 mm. One full turn of the knob moves the
blade approximately 0.5 mm.
